We continue our Ultimate Berlin Guide with the Top-5 Restaurants, curated to fit the fans’ profile, so don’t expect expensive Michelin star restaurants in this list, but rather cozy and intimate casual eateries serving honest and tasty food, loved by locals.

  1. Lokal: The cuisine in the restaurant is different every day but always modern. Homemade and creative you could call it. Ambitious and colorful in any case! Many seasonal and regional foods end up on the plate.

  1. St. Bart: Bar & kitchen with simple tiled décor plating contemporary gastropub dishes & oysters.

  1. Otto: Seasonal small plates & wine served in an intimate, industrial-style venue with a leafy terrace.

  1. Sarajevo Berlin: Informal Bosnian dishes & desserts are served in this down-to-earth restaurant with a terrace.

  1. Salumeria Lamuri: Trendy eatery in a former butcher’s shop offering a changing menu of creative Italian cuisine.
